Hi, I see this script hasn't been touched for 3-4 years... so does is make sense to deploy it on latest Chaos Chalmer OpenWrt or OpenWrt already has bufferbload under control?

dtaht commented 8 years ago

sqm-scripts is part of openwrt now and is actively developed, so, no.

The only extra thing the debloat scripts did was also lower buffering on ath9k derived wifi chips which helps on some workloads, but not enough. There are also some choice log entries as to the amount of science and experimentation we did way back then that I'd like to preserve.

About the only other reason debloat still exists was that it contained stuff to automate things like qfq setup, which was one of the stepping stones towards fq-codel, which is much simpler than qfq is. I am still hoping that an easier to configure qfq+fq_codel arrives one day.
